123下一页
返回列表 发帖
查看: 3449|回复: 27

[已解决] 从3.4(gbk)升级到3.5后出现奇怪问题

3

主题

31

回帖

36

积分

初学乍练

贡献
0 点
金币
0 个
发表于 2023-4-9 22:17:52 | 显示全部楼层 |阅读模式

从3.4(gbk)升级到3.5后,页面提示升级成功,前后uc通讯都是绿色状态,管理员浏览和发帖都正常,但是出现了一些问题:

首先是论坛无法管理个人信息,就算清除了用户安全提问和重新设置密码无效(所以文件权限都开了root和777),也就是说只有一个管理员创始人正常登录,其他用户都是密码错误,新注册用户直接是uid2的新用户用户,但是后台能看到所有的注册用户数据。 我GBK用户升级后用户的安全问答会清空,但是密码不会清空吧。

搜索了许多无果,选择尝试使用了去掉uc模块保留论坛独立后台这个功能。



一轮下来问题依旧,请问下出现这种情况如何恢复使用,或者至少能让管理员改密码?

我知道答案 回答被采纳将会获得1 贡献 已有27人回答
回复

使用道具 举报

3

主题

31

回帖

36

积分

初学乍练

贡献
0 点
金币
0 个
 楼主| 发表于 2023-4-9 22:23:30 | 显示全部楼层
其次,还有一个界面的问题,上面的是我的论坛,下面是discuz官方的,显示怎么断层了?用的都是官方文件啊,还需要去哪里单独开启吗? 问题有点多,谢谢各位大佬了。


iShot_2023-04-09_22.21.15.jpg


回复 支持 反对

使用道具 举报

3

主题

31

回帖

36

积分

初学乍练

贡献
0 点
金币
0 个
 楼主| 发表于 2023-4-9 22:24:41 | 显示全部楼层
3.4的时候删除过许多用户,被注册机爆破了,各位删除,不知道是不是这个原因导致的,
回复 支持 反对

使用道具 举报

56

主题

1457

回帖

3万

积分

管理员

贡献
2072 点
金币
1383 个
发表于 2023-4-9 23:00:20 来自手机 | 显示全部楼层
uc里的会员数据可能不完整
回复 支持 反对

使用道具 举报

3

主题

31

回帖

36

积分

初学乍练

贡献
0 点
金币
0 个
 楼主| 发表于 2023-4-9 23:21:10 | 显示全部楼层
dashen 发表于 2023-4-9 23:00
uc里的会员数据可能不完整

我已经去掉uc模块保留论坛独立后台这个功能。
https://www.dismall.com/thread-14866-1-1.html

论坛能看到用户帖子、空间、照片、头像、等一切信息,包括后台也能一键下载用户的信息,为什么就是用户登录不了(不管密码是否正确都是提示:登录失败),就算这样,管理员也应该能改密码吗?这种情况下应该如何恢复
回复 支持 反对

使用道具 举报

12

主题

1607

回帖

2716

积分

Giter

贡献
143 点
金币
353 个
发表于 2023-4-10 00:56:36 | 显示全部楼层
从你描述的现象上来看,你中间极有可能是出现问题了,而且问题不小。你看一下config文件夹里的ucenter配置,找到配置里指向的那个数据库,看看里面的members表(前面加上配置里的前缀,默认加上以后是pre_ucenter_members,自己改过的话按改过的来)的内容是否正常
回复 支持 反对

使用道具 举报

3

主题

31

回帖

36

积分

初学乍练

贡献
0 点
金币
0 个
 楼主| 发表于 2023-4-10 09:46:20 | 显示全部楼层
专家 发表于 2023-4-10 00:56
从你描述的现象上来看,你中间极有可能是出现问题了,而且问题不小。你看一下config文件夹里的ucenter配置 ...

你好,我查询了数据库,你写的那个找不到,缩小到搜索members倒有一些,点开那个uc member可以全部看到用户数据,具体截图,应该如何恢复同步呢?谢谢
iShot_2023-04-10_09.42.42.jpg iShot_2023-04-10_09.43.17.jpg
回复 支持 反对

使用道具 举报

3

主题

31

回帖

36

积分

初学乍练

贡献
0 点
金币
0 个
 楼主| 发表于 2023-4-10 12:24:03 | 显示全部楼层
专家 发表于 2023-4-10 00:56
从你描述的现象上来看,你中间极有可能是出现问题了,而且问题不小。你看一下config文件夹里的ucenter配置 ...

再补充一下:
回滚dz3.4后,管理员是可以正常修改用户密码的。但是在dz后台添加用户出现数据库错误(如图),前台能登录,pma后台也能找到这个用户。

而当前dz3.5后台添加用户正常,没有报错。但是uid从2开始排,之前用户的信息无法读取。
回复 支持 反对

使用道具 举报

18

主题

1836

回帖

2817

积分

应用开发者

贡献
53 点
金币
624 个
QQ
发表于 2023-4-10 12:32:08 | 显示全部楼层
summersun 发表于 2023-4-10 12:24
再补充一下:
回滚dz3.4后,管理员是可以正常修改用户密码的。但是在dz后台添加用户出现数据库错误(如图 ...

根据这个情况你应该是 uc部分的数据没升级到新版本的 建议升级时看看uc具体报错 修复后再升级
无限星辰工作室  好集导航 免费API
服务Discuz建站|定制|小程序|APP定制|故障维修|搬家|运维|挂马清理|防护|性能优化|安全运维|
服务理念:专业 诚信 友好QQ842062626 服务
回复 支持 反对

使用道具 举报

3

主题

31

回帖

36

积分

初学乍练

贡献
0 点
金币
0 个
 楼主| 发表于 2023-4-10 15:34:47 | 显示全部楼层
crx349 发表于 2023-4-10 12:32
根据这个情况你应该是 uc部分的数据没升级到新版本的 建议升级时看看uc具体报错 修复后再升级 ...

升级uc1.7的时候,是出现过错误,但都是一闪而过,0.几秒吧,最后也是提升升级成功了,前后通讯都正常。3.5有什么方法补救吗?
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

  • 关注公众号
  • 有偿服务微信
  • 有偿服务QQ

手机版|小黑屋|Discuz! 官方交流社区 ( 皖ICP备16010102号 |皖公网安备34010302002376号 )|网站地图|star

GMT+8, 2024-5-4 16:38 , Processed in 0.045591 second(s), 9 queries , Redis On.

Powered by Discuz! W1.0 Licensed

Cpoyright © 2001-2024 Discuz! Team.

关灯 在本版发帖
有偿服务QQ
有偿服务微信
返回顶部
快速回复 返回顶部 返回列表